Lot Le Département is a key governmental organization dedicated to the administrative and developmental needs of the Lot region in France. Focused on enhancing the quality of life for its residents, the institution manages a variety of public services, including education, transportation, and infrastructure. By fostering local initiatives, Lot Le Département plays a vital role in promoting economic growth and cultural preservation within the community.
The mission of Lot Le Département is to ensure the smooth functioning of everyday services that residents rely on, such as waste management and public health. It also prioritizes environmental sustainability, implementing policies aimed at protecting the region’s natural resources.
